About Kalwa Chhotabas Village

Kalwa Chhotabas is a mid sized village in Makrana tehsil, in the district of Nagaur, Rajasthan.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 1,795, made up of 896 males and 899 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,003 females per 1000 males. The village covers 1033.33 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 341502,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Kalwa Chhotabas

The census records public bus service for Kalwa Chhotabas as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within <5 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
